EVANSTON, Ill. – Northwestern women's basketball returns home to Welsh-Ryan Arena as the Wildcats prepare to take on Purdue on Saturday afternoon. Tip-off between the Wildcats and the Boilermakers is set for 2 p.m.

Northwestern (6-10, 0-6) will come back to Evanston after falling 93-64 to the No. 12 Iowa Hawkeyes on Wednesday. Saturday's matchup will be the 77th all-time meeting between the Wildcats and Boilermakers (11-5, 2-4), with Purdue leading the overall series, 50-26. Northwestern has won its last four meetings against the Boilermakers, dating back to its Big Ten Championship season in 2020.

Caileigh Walsh comes into Saturday's bout as the Wildcats' leading scorer, with 12.6 points per game on the year. Walsh led both teams in scoring in Wednesday's game against the Hawkeyes with 22 points, just two points off of her career high. She also tied for a team-leading five rebounds. Walsh has also been dominant on the other end, as she's fifth in the Big Ten in blocks per game (1.3).

Graduate student Sydney Wood continues to lead Northwestern on the defensive end, tallying 41 steals and 16 blocks. Her 2.6 steals per game are currently second in the Big Ten, and Wood added to that total against Iowa with three.

Overall, Northwestern ranks as the best shot-blocking team in the Big Ten. The 'Cats average five per game, led by the efforts of Walsh, Wood, Paige Mott and Courtney Shaw.

Purdue travels to Evanston with an 11-5 record, but has lost its last two. Last time out against No. 17 Michigan on Tuesday, the Wolverines began the game on a 13-2 run and never looked back, winning 80-59. The Boilermakers are led by Lasha Petree, who had scored in double-digits in three consecutive games before being held to a season-low four points against Michigan. The Boilermakers rank fourth in the Big Ten in opponent field goal percentage.

In the 2021-2022 season, Northwestern swept Purdue in two meetings. When the Wildcats traveled to West Lafayette, Indiana on Feb. 4, Northwestern won 80-67. Veronica Burton starred with 26 points, six rebounds and six steals, and Shaw nearly added a double-double in the victory. Twenty days later, the Wildcats came out on top again 68-51, this time at home. Northwestern was powered by a dominant 20-point performance by Lauryn Satterwhite, while Burton contributed with 12 points and eight assists and Shaw totaled a double-double.

After hosting Purdue, the Wildcats will hit the road to take on Ohio State in Columbus, Ohio. Tip-off between the two teams is set for 5:30 p.m. on Thursday, Jan. 19.
